Participating in your first PGL CS2 tournament can be an exhilarating experience, but preparation is key to making the most of it. Start by familiarizing yourself with the tournament rules and format; knowing the structure will help you strategize effectively. Additionally, consider organizing practice sessions with your team to refine your communication and teamwork skills. It's essential to build a solid team synergy, as this can greatly influence your performance during matches. Don't forget to check your equipment, ensuring that your mouse, keyboard, and headset are all in optimal condition.
Another critical aspect of preparing for a PGL CS2 tournament is to develop a comprehensive game plan. Analyze potential opponents by watching their gameplay and identifying their strengths and weaknesses. Create a detailed strategy guide that outlines your team's approach to different scenarios, such as eco rounds or retakes. Practice these strategies in scrims to ensure everyone knows their roles and responsibilities. Lastly, manage your mental and physical well-being; keep a balanced diet, stay hydrated, and get enough sleep leading up to the tournament to ensure you are at your best when game day arrives.
